					<description><![CDATA[New research has revealed significant insights into the recovery journey of older patients who have endured a subacute stroke. By employing a sophisticated anchor-based adjusted predictive modeling approach, researchers have delved deep into the nuances of functional independence and the critical measures that indicate clinically meaningful change during the rehabilitation phase.
